The 21700 lithium battery, with its cylindrical shape measuring 21mm in diameter and 70mm in height, offers a higher capacity and energy density compared to its predecessor, the 18650 battery. This increase in capacity makes it an appealing choice for manufacturers looking to enhance performance while optimizing space. As the demand for sustainable energy solutions rises, so does the need for durable and long-lasting batteries that are capable of powering diverse applications over longer periods.

One of the pivotal aspects influencing battery longevity is the quality of the raw materials used in production. Top-tier 21700 lithium batteries often utilize premium lithium-ion cells, refined electrolytes, and advanced separator technologies. Buyers should scrutinize product specifications, ensuring that the battery chemistry supports a longer lifespan. Additionally, it is beneficial to inquire about production processes, as manufacturers that employ high-quality control measures are more likely to deliver consistent performance over time.

In addition to material quality, the design of the battery also impacts its lifespan. Features such as thermal management systems can prevent overheating, which is a common cause of battery degradation. Buyers should evaluate design elements that enhance safety, thermal stability, and overall efficiency. This can often be gleaned from technical datasheets, where manufacturers provide insights into the charge cycles and expected longevity under various conditions.
